The Texas Girls Collaborative Project (TxGCP) is a statewide network of advocates and educators from non-profits, K-12 schools, universities and colleges, and companies across Texas and beyond who are committed to motivating and supporting women and girls to pursue and thrive in careers in STEM. TxGCP leads the annual Texas Women & Girls in STEM Summit, disseminates curriculum and effective practices, and supports a network of collaborators, resource sharing and STEM communications throughout the state. TxGCP is a state collaborative of the National Girls Collaborative Project powered by STEMwise Connections.
Due to the passage of SB17 (anti DEI in higher ed bill - https://compliance.utexas.edu/sb17), as of November 2023, the Texas Girls Collaborative Project (TxGCP) operations have moved outside The University of Texas at Austin. While TxGCP maintained limited operation and core programming over the past year under great uncertainty, strategy and overall leadership/community engagement was on hold.
